About Us : IQVIA is a global leader in healthcare intelligence and clinical research. We are dedicated to helping our clients drive healthcare forward by combining unparalleled data, advanced analytics, cutting-edge technologies, and deep healthcare and scientific expertise.

Job Overview : IQVIA Site Enablement Solutions (SES) is a unique service providing site-based clinical research staff to trial sites globally. Reporting to the Sr. Director, Global Head, Site Enablement Solutions (SES), this director will have specific responsibilities related to the expansion and maintenance of SES services in countries outside of the US (in EMEA). This role will also be a key contributor to the SES Leadership team and collaborate with colleagues within IQVIA’s Patient and Site Centric Solutions (PSCS) team.
